Fix 2: Install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able (Visual Studio 2015)
This is by far the best and the easiest fix of this guide. Moreover, reinstallation is always known to fix most of the runtime error issues, and VCRUNTIME140.dll is no different. Follow the steps below to install and reinstall.
- Download and install the Microsoft Visual C++ 2015 Redistributable Update 3 RC file from the official Microsoft site (Link Below)
- Launch the .exe file and choose the x64 or x86 files when prompted according to your system.
- Agree with the terms and conditions and then click on “Install.” Restart your PC.

Fix 3: Repair Microsoft Visual C++ 2015 Redistributable
Repairing Microsoft Visual C++ is quite easy; you just have to select Repair instead of uninstalling. So follow the steps below to try it out yourself. However, this is too known to solve most of the issues.
- Navigate to Control Panel > Add/Remove Programs and select Microsoft Visual C++ 2015 Redistributable (x64 or x86). Click on “Change.”
- You will have a choice to Uninstall or Repair it. Choose Repair, and restart your PC when done. If the issue still isn’t resolved, read the next section below.

Fix 5: Run a System File Checker scan
This system file checker is quite helpful in solving most of the system errors. This checks whether there is an issue like missing or corrupted files in the system.
- Click on Start > Type Command Prompt and right-click on it. Select “Run as Administrator.”
- Type the following command:
sfc/scannow
- Then hit Enter.
- Wait for the issue to be checked by the system. When it’s done, restart your computer and re-launch the game.

Fix 6: Update your Windows OS
Windows updates cannot always be blamed for introducing new system errors. They even solve most of the errors a system has. To update your operating system, follow the steps below.
- Navigate to Start > Settings > Update & Security > Windows Update > Check for updates
- Download any latest update there, if available. Wait for it to be installed, and then restart your computer and re-launch the game.
After all, if you still face the issue, it is best to opt for the reinstallation of the Rocket League. Just go to the control panel, go to add or remove programs. Then find your game and uninstall it. Now restart your computer and install the game from steam.
